OBITUARY: Rovena Snyder with picture Rovena Irene Luksas Snyder, 51, of Plainville, died Monday, Feb. 25, 2002 at home surrounded by her loving family. Born in Hahns, Germany, she was the daughter of Irene Luksas of Plainville and the late Peter Luksas. She was a former New Britain resident before moving to Plainville. Rovena was employed at the State Dept. of Mental Retardation in Newington. She was a devoted worker and was loved by the people she worked with.
